Le poste Un Développeur de processus de test C et Go sur Echirolles
Partager cette offre
Smarteo recherche pour l'un de ses clients, Un Développeur de processus de test C et Go sur Echirolles
Description:
A propos de l'équipe
La R&D logiciel du client lance la création d'un nouveau produit autour du monitoring des supercalculateurs (HPC). Ce produit aura pour vocation d'aider l'utilisateur à prendre des décisions pour optimiser l'énergie et les performances d'exécution de ses jobs. Composé de 5 à 8 personnes, l'équipe de développement aura pour objectifs de :
Développer les outils de collecte des métriques systèmes et MPI afin de monitorer l'exécution des jobs
Construire les APIs permettant de croiser les métriques issues de plusieurs autres outils (énergie, données)
Concevoir des algorithmes permettant de comparer les jobs au regard de leur métriques
Intégrer les composants au sein d'une interface utilisateur commune
Dans ce cadre, nous recherchons un développeur motivé pour développer le processus de test et de release de la solution. Ses missions principales seront :
Le développement de tests unitaires (C, Go)
La recherche de solutions logicielles pour l'écriture de tests automatiques
L'écriture de processus d'intégration continue sous GitHub Actions (build, lint, test, rapport SonarQube, publication sur Artifactory)
L'automatisation des montées de versions de dépendance (Dependabot) et leur test
Une collaboration étroite sera nécessaire avec l'équipe de développement ainsi qu'avec les autres équipes dans le but d'homogénéiser les bonnes pratiques
Si vous êtes intéressé, merci de me faire parvenir votre TJM ainsi que votre CV à jour au format Word
Profil recherché
Le développement de tests unitaires (C, Go)
La recherche de solutions logicielles pour l'écriture de tests automatiques
L'écriture de processus d'intégration continue sous GitHub Actions (build, lint, test, rapport SonarQube, publication sur Artifactory)
L'automatisation des montées de versions de dépendance (Dependabot) et leur test
Une collaboration étroite sera nécessaire avec l'équipe de développement ainsi qu'avec les autres équipes dans le but d'homogénéiser les bonnes pratiques
Environnement de travail
A propos de l'équipe
La R&D logiciel du client lance la création d'un nouveau produit autour du monitoring des supercalculateurs (HPC). Ce produit aura pour vocation d'aider l'utilisateur à prendre des décisions pour optimiser l'énergie et les performances d'exécution de ses jobs. Composé de 5 à 8 personnes, l'équipe de développement aura pour objectifs de :
Développer les outils de collecte des métriques systèmes et MPI afin de monitorer l'exécution des jobs
Construire les APIs permettant de croiser les métriques issues de plusieurs autres outils (énergie, données)
Concevoir des algorithmes permettant de comparer les jobs au regard de leur métriques
Intégrer les composants au sein d'une interface utilisateur commune
Postulez à cette offre !
Trouvez votre prochaine mission parmi +8 000 offres !
-
Fixez vos conditions
Rémunération, télétravail... Définissez tous les critères importants pour vous.
-
Faites-vous chasser
Les recruteurs viennent directement chercher leurs futurs talents dans notre CVthèque.
-
100% gratuit
Aucune commission prélevée sur votre mission freelance.
Un Développeur de processus de test C et Go sur Echirolles
Smarteo